About the Author

黒井秋夫 is a distinguished Japanese author and scholar whose work delves deeply into the lingering scars of war and the pursuit of peace in post-conflict societies. With a background in historical and cultural studies, he explores the unspoken traumas of Japan and Asia, giving voice to the marginalized victims whose stories have long been overlooked. Through meticulous research and empathetic narrative, 黒井 examines how collective memory shapes national identities and fosters reconciliation. His writing bridges academic rigor with accessible storytelling, offering profound insights into the human cost of conflict and the resilient paths to healing. A committed advocate for peace education, he continues to influence discussions on war's aftermath in contemporary Asia.
